Output fffc76a140ac1837dcc6cf3ba2fb0a01ac52804c28af27ce8cbe363351688702:1

value
30935113
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 47b9d5efbfecf83658af24178bafd2cc6174b1dd OP_EQUALVERIFY OP_CHECKSIG
address
17YFbiBYzpC59EViw5kVtrzjL1a67doTUx
transaction
fffc76a140ac1837dcc6cf3ba2fb0a01ac52804c28af27ce8cbe363351688702
confirmations
263031
spent
true